Sendwave is a mobile-first remittance company that specializes in enabling instant money transfers from North America, Europe, and Asia to mobile wallets and bank accounts in Africa, Asia, and other emerging markets.[1] Sendwave operates as a separate brand under Zepz, formerly WorldRemit Group, following an acquisition in 2021.[2]
History
Sendwave was founded in 2014 and was owned by Chime Inc. to facilitate remittances to African countries, starting with Kenya and Ghana. The company emphasized direct transfers to mobile money wallets, reflecting the growing adoption of mobile financial services in Africa.[3][4][5]
The first Sendwave markets outside of Africa launched in 2020, targeting South Asian countries such as Bangladesh and Sri Lanka.[6]
